Property Prices in Carlton NSW 2218

Property prices in Carlton NSW 2218 as of June 2026: the median house price is $1.82M (+8.5% YoY) and the median unit price is $710K (+5.2% YoY). Houses sell in 27 days on average. Gross rental yields are 2.8% for houses and 4.3% for units. Data sourced from CoreLogic and Domain.

Is Carlton a Good Suburb to Buy Property in 2026?

Arguments For

  • +Carlton house prices grew 8.5% in the past year — strong capital growth driven by infrastructure investment and lifestyle demand.
  • +Rental yields of 2.8% (houses) and 4.3% (units) provide reliable income for investors.
  • +Pre-CGT reform demand (effective 1 July 2026) is attracting investors who want to lock in current favourable tax settings.
  • +Carlton's position in the St George corridor — close to the CBD, airport, and beaches — supports long-term property value growth.

Arguments Against

  • Entry-level house prices start at $1.45M — high barriers to entry compared to outer suburbs.
  • RBA cash rate at 4.10% increases borrowing costs, reducing purchasing power for buyers with large mortgages.
  • Stamp duty on a $1.82M house can exceed $60K for non-first-home buyers — factor this into your total acquisition cost.
  • If buying for investment, the proposed negative gearing changes (1 July 2026) may reduce future tax deductions on new purchases.
